William Mills & Son 1966 Catalog 2-Piece no scuffs are left) and64 pages. Near fine condition. 1966 marks the Arthur C. Mills' year of retirement and passing of the torch to his son, Stephen W. Mills. This is noted in the opening letter to fellow sportsmen. Rods featured such as H. L. Leonard and Orvis bamboo, Leonard glass, Fenwick glass, et al. Reels featured such as Arthur Walker salmon reels, Leonard Mills Trout & Fairy, Hardy (Lightweight Series, Perfect, St. George, St. John), Pflueger, Alcedo & Quick
